SUMMARY:A sharp counterexample to local existence of low regularity soluti
 ons to Einstein's equations in wave coordinates - Hans Lindblad (Johns Hop
 kins)
DTSTART:20161205T150000Z
DTEND:20161205T160000Z
UID:TALK67464@talks.cam.ac.uk
CONTACT:Prof. Mihalis Dafermos
DESCRIPTION:We give a sharp counter example to local existence of low regu
 larity solutions to Einstein's equations in wave coordinates. We show that
  there are initial data in H2 satisfying the wave coordinate condition suc
 h that there is no solution in H2 to Einstein's equations in wave coordina
 tes for any positive time. This result is sharp since Klainerman–Rodnian
 ski and Smith–Tataru proved existence for the same equations with slight
 ly more regular initial data.\n\nThis is joint work with Boris Ettinger.
